Affiliate Programs: The Problems...
Okay for the past week I've been signing up to this affiliate program and that affiliate program.
I'm not going to name names as that's not the point of the post. What I'm going to do is point out the 'problems' I've run into. Hopefully this will get them to see the light and be more efficient.
First off, one big named affiliate program does an excellent job of simple, easy to use and post product. No razzle-dazzle menu laden webmaster consoles, just simple to use and get on about your business options. Only one problem with them, they should name their pics in an unique way instead of 1, 2, 3, etc. Like I've got all freakin' day renaming shit???
Other problems. Only 3 of them didn't email the webmaster with their acceptance data. We were prompted that we would be emailed yet days have dragged on. Those are days of unproductivity. 2 of these sites didn't even give you the " please print this information for your files " option.

Promo: If you intend to do an affiliate program and decide to provide banners for promo, HIRE A PROFESSIONAL to create them. It ain't that difficult. There are probably dozens right here on GFY alone.
Instructions: I'm a webmaster, not 'Scotty from Star Trek'. Your linking and program instructions should be understood at a glance. I'm trying to make money not decipher the ancient scrolls of Atlantis.
User/Password: If we sign up with a username and password that is approved, then that username/password should work after we've signed up. That raises a red flag because if our user/pass is screwed up, then what about our customers???
Galleries: If you're going to provide hosted galleries don't put things like ' For our webmasters only ' and still post them as accessible by us. We don't need more taunting. Message boards: If you advertise that you have a webmaster's board on your affiliate site it would be a good idea to actually HAVE a webmaster's board. If not, remove the big-ass flickering colorful 60pt. text that says so. Message boards are valuable commodities as we can troubleshoot together.
Payouts: I'll leave that alone til I'm done with my surveys.
Support: That's what support means, SUPPORT, 'NOT' wiseass comebacks. If I wanted to be demeaned by someone who's solicited me to sell their product I would be a civil servant. A big red flag is raised when lack of accord is present. If you'll be a snide assed bitch to someone promoting your product how will you treat the customer buying it?
